Arbre ( truc facile)

Arbre ( truc facile) - C - Programmation

Marsh Posté le 03-06-2013 à 15:29:26    

Salut à tous,
je veux juste savoir si cette fonction est juste :  
je veux créer la racine d'une arbre ... et merci d'avance  :)  
 
ma structure est définie par : struct cellule { int val;
                                                             struct cellule *fg;
                                                             struct cellule *fd;
                                                           };
                                       Type def struct cellule *Arbre;
 
la fonction :  
   Arbre Creer(int x)
{ arbre A ;
A=malloc(sizeof(struct cellule));
A->val=x;
A-> fg=NULL;
A->fd=NULL;
Return A;
}  
 
 
 

Reply

Marsh Posté le 03-06-2013 à 15:29:26   

Reply

Marsh Posté le 03-06-2013 à 21:12:26    

En général on vérifie que l'allocation a réussi

Code :
  1. if (A != NULL)
  2. {   A->val=x;
  3.     A-> fg=NULL;
  4.     A->fd=NULL;
  5. }

Reply

Marsh Posté le 04-06-2013 à 01:41:27    

ok merci :)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ed